    As far as plans for the car, it's my fun car, but I'm not going all out with it or anything. I want it to still be streetable. I really just need a S-AFC and wideband and I can get a good tune on it and be happy. I've already done the basic stuff to get it to this point. I don't mind sharing so here goes

    1991 TSI AWD
    Braided SS clutch line
    VDO boost guage
    Centerforce D/F 2500 clutch
    Swapped the blown motor for a GVR-4 RS motor, all stock internals still. The RS motor has stock 510CC injectors and a B16G turbo
    Functioning Cyclone intake runners set to 4K rpm or 13 psi
    manual boost controller (18 psi for the 13.7 I ran)
    GR-2 shocks to replace the blown factory ones
    2G mas
    2.5 turbo back that I will most likely up to a 3" soon (built it myself)
    PTE front mount with 2.5" piping (made the piping myself)
    Walbro 195lph rewired (probably upgrade to a 255 if I plan on running over 25psi)
    94 front big brake upgrade from a Diamante
    annnnd...that's about all I've done right now. With the exception of all the little things like plug wires and stuff like that.

    Once I get the SAFC and wideband I can dyno tune it and try for a better pass at the track.

    Thanks for the warm welcome! Yeah, I know where I'd liek for th ecar to be. Getting it there....well...time and money. I've got the time

    I also need to swap the rear three bolt set up to a four bolt when money allows. Too many drag launches will eventually end the life of the factory three bolt. I plan on finishing up the body work and painting it this summer. It kinda look's like ass in person. Fadded paint, dented fender, hail damage on the roof. But hey, it was $600 for the car, so I can't complain. I already swapped the rear bumper cover and lights to a 1Gb set up and I'm switching to 1Gb side skirts. The pop up's stay though. It's what makes the car IMO. Besides, little kids absolutly FLIP OUT when they see them pop up. It's hilarious!
